Some of the finest wines in the country or even the world come from a special area in upstate New York – the Finger Lakes. There are over 100 wineries and vineyards within the finger lakes area surrounding Seneca, Cayuga, Canandaigua, Keuka, Conesus and Hemlock lakes. The inaugural pairing will be Salmon Run’s Meritage and our Baby Gouda Cheese!

This is a delightful wine produced at Dr. Konstantin Frank Wines in Hammondsport,NY. Salmon Run Meritage is an amazing blend of red Bordeaux varieties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c and Merlot. All of which are age-worthy red wines, barrel aged in French oak barrels for a year. Meritage pairs well with cow milk cheese, so naturally our gouda made from our very own farms milk is the perfect combination. The Salmon Run Meritage being a bordeaux style wine has a great depth of flavor pairing extremely well with baby gouda. For more information on Dr Frank’s Salmon Run Meritage, follow the links below. Until next time enjoy!
